About Hall Cottage

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Hall Cottage is a three-bedroom detached house in Kennington, Ashford, Ashford (TN25 4EB). It has a recorded floor area of 97 m² (around 1044 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. Tenure is freehold. It is a listed building, which means external alterations are tightly controlled but it may qualify for heritage tax reliefs. Period features are noted in the property record. The latest certificate (July 2014)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 79),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from July 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Most recent transfer was July 2025 at £575,000 — fresh data. 3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2014–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.8%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£551/sq ft) was about 69.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 97 m² it's 26.1%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(131 m² median across 8 EPCs).
